In Redding, California, the maintenance requirements for chimneys can differ significantly between older, established properties and newer constructions, largely due to variations in building materials and venting technologies. Older homes might feature masonry chimneys with clay tile liners, which require careful inspection for mortar degradation and tile integrity, especially considering the region's dry climate which can increase fire risks. Newer homes often utilize prefabricated metal chimneys, which demand specific cleaning techniques to avoid damaging the metal components. What affects the price

The final cost for your chimney service depends on a few specific factors. We look at the total height of the chimney stack, the level of creosote buildup inside the flue, and whether you have a standard masonry fireplace or a prefabricated metal insert. If there are structural blockages like nests or excessive debris that require extra labor, that will also adjust the estimate. We avoid hidden fees, but every setup is unique, so we evaluate the condition of your liner and firebox upon inspection.

How does chimney cleaning differ from chimney repair?

Chimney cleaning, or sweeping, is a routine maintenance process focused on removing accumulated soot and creosote from the inside of the flue to prevent fires and ensure proper draft. Chimney repair, conversely, addresses structural damage, such as cracked masonry, deteriorating mortar, or damaged flue liners. While cleaning is a preventative measure, repairs are necessary to fix existing problems and restore the chimney's integrity and safety. A professional cleaning often includes an inspection that can identify the need for repairs.
